Rooster Talk Episode 61 is with Matthew Boyes, Managing Director of Red Dirt Metals Limited (ASX: RDT). The Mt Ida project is fast becoming a double bonus for Red Dirt Metals as exploration is unveiling the gold credits. When we were first introduced to the Mt. Ida project (Red Dirt Metals Limited (ASX:RDT) - A Lithium Gem within a Gold Mine.) in April 2022, we were just trying to understand the lithium potential. As the market was having a lithium boom, it would be foolish to not discuss what is the flavour of the last two years. As we were talking through that Coffee with Samso with Matt Boyes, I was really interested with the gold potential. The Mt Ida story is very similar to what had occurred at Mt. Holland a few years ago. For those that have not heard the story, Mt Holland was all about the discovery of a lithium bonanza because of a phone call. Mt. Holland was a legitimate gold mining project but was later found to be a greater lithium project. When you hear Matt talk about the lithium prospectivity in Mt. Ida, you can hear the frustration of not being able to rush into the gold project. The potential is yet to be finalised. In saying that, you can also feel the frustration of not being able to unwrapped the potential of the lithium prospectivity. The fact that there is still a large package of landholding that the company has not explored is definitely high on the list of things to do. Matt is definite that there will be a resource coming out for the lithium and in time, there will be a gold resource to be released as well. When that will be is the magic question.
